PARIS – French hotel chain Accor SA says the manager of one of its hotels in Ivory Coast missing since he was kidnapped about two months ago has been confirmed killed.
Accor CEO Denis Hennequin said in Thursday’s statement he was “deeply shaken and shocked by this revolting murder” of Stephane Frantz di Rippel, who was general manager of the Novotel Abidjan at the time of his kidnapping.

Accor said it is still waiting for the results of the investigation concerning the three other hotel clients kidnapped with di Rippel, including another French citizen.
The four have been missing since April 4, when around a dozen armed gunmen entered the hotel and kidnapped the men.
